* Registered parameter types go in their own files
* Moves [int, float] item definitions outside `WidgetParameterItem`
* Moves [int, float] parameter definitions outside `WidgetParameterItem`
* Allow registering ParameterItems for easy parameter defs
* Finalizes moving simple parameters to their own files
* removes accidentally committed file
* Provides class qualnames in rst
* Address docstring build issues
* Address recent review comments
- `registerParameterItemType`:
* added to docs and parametertree.__init__
* Remove unsed PARAM_TYPES global
* Hyperlink to `registerParameterType`
- parameter tree rst:
* Alphabetize entries
* Rebuild RST without fully qualified class name
* Add note at file header that it is auto generated
* Remove spurious space during rst doc creation
* Ensure created/modified files end with newline
* Address CodeQL warnings
* toPlainText also returns str
* `QTreeWidgetItem.text` returns str
- Increase cross-referencing
- Give all built-in parameter and parameter items at least minimal
docstring
- Start improving coverage of the special options available for some
parameters
- Organize the built in parameters reference for easier navigation